CSV(逗号分隔值)文件是一种常见的文件格式,用于存储表格数据。Python作为一门强大的编程语言,提供了多种方式来读取和分析CSV文件。本文将揭开Python读取外部CSV文件的路径奥秘,帮助你轻松...
CSV(逗号分隔值)文件是一种常见的文件格式,用于存储表格数据。Python作为一门强大的编程语言,提供了多种方式来读取和分析CSV文件。本文将揭开Python读取外部CSV文件的路径奥秘,帮助你轻松导入与分析数据。
csv模块Python的csv模块是处理CSV文件的标准工具。以下是如何使用csv模块读取CSV文件的基本步骤:
csv模块import csvwith open('data.csv', mode='r', encoding='utf-8') as file: reader = csv.reader(file)for row in reader: print(row)以上代码将读取data.csv文件,并打印出每一行。
pandas库pandas是一个强大的数据分析库,它提供了read_csv函数来读取CSV文件。
pandaspip install pandaspandas读取CSV文件import pandas as pd
df = pd.read_csv('data.csv')
print(df)pandas将CSV文件的内容存储在一个DataFrame对象中,这使得后续的数据分析更加方便。
有时CSV文件可能包含特殊格式,如日期格式、逗号分隔的数值等。以下是如何处理这些特殊格式的示例:
df = pd.read_csv('data.csv', parse_dates=['date_column'])df = pd.read_csv('data.csv', delimiter=';')读取CSV文件后,你可以使用pandas提供的丰富功能来分析数据,例如:
通过使用Python内置的csv模块或pandas库,你可以轻松地读取和分析CSV文件。掌握这些技巧,让你的数据瞬间变活,为数据分析和决策提供有力支持。